About

Xin Bai is a scholar working on Computational Mechanics, Biomedical Engineering and Molecular Biology. According to data from OpenAlex, Xin Bai has authored 39 papers receiving a total of 388 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 9 papers in Computational Mechanics, 7 papers in Biomedical Engineering and 5 papers in Molecular Biology. Recurrent topics in Xin Bai’s work include Genomics and Phylogenetic Studies (4 papers), Fluid Dynamics Simulations and Interactions (4 papers) and Lattice Boltzmann Simulation Studies (4 papers). Xin Bai is often cited by papers focused on Genomics and Phylogenetic Studies (4 papers), Fluid Dynamics Simulations and Interactions (4 papers) and Lattice Boltzmann Simulation Studies (4 papers). Xin Bai collaborates with scholars based in China, United Kingdom and United States. Xin Bai's co-authors include John Williams, Lanhao Zhao, Tongchun Li, Jia Mao, Xiaoqing Liu, Jiahong Zheng, Wei Zhang, Kim Dan Nguyen, Damien Pham Van Bang and Beibei Wang and has published in prestigious journals such as Nature Communications, Advanced Functional Materials and Scientific Reports.
